Mityukov, Mikhail Alekseevich

Plenipotentiary Representative of the President of the Russian Federation in the Constitutional Court since June 1998 (reappointed to this position in June 2000); was born on January 7, 1942 in the village. Ust-Uda, Irkutsk region; graduated from the Faculty of Law of the Irkutsk State University in 1968, candidate of legal sciences; State Counselor of Justice of the Russian Federation, 1st class; he began his career in 1959 at the construction of a power line-500 in the Krasnoyarsk Territory; since 1968 - judge, 1979-1987 - deputy chairman of the regional court of the Khakass Autonomous Region, chairman of the judicial board for civil, then criminal cases; 1987-1990 - Senior Lecturer, Head of the Department of History of the Abakan State Pedagogical Institute; in 1990 he was elected a people's deputy of the Russian Federation, a member of the Council of the Republic and a member of the Presidium of the Supreme Council, was a member of the Free Russia faction, participated in the work of the Radical Democrats faction; 1990-1993 - permanent job in the Supreme Council of the Russian Federation, was the chairman of the Committee of the Supreme Council on Legislation, a member of the Constitutional Commission and the Commission for Legislative Support of Decrees of the President of the Russian Federation; 1993-1995 - First Deputy Minister of Justice of the Russian Federation, at the same time was the Chairman of the Commission for Legislative Assumptions under the President of the Russian Federation (1993-1994); in 1993 he was elected to the State Duma of the Federal Assembly of the Russian Federation of the first convocation, was a member of the Russia's Choice faction, until December 1995 he was the first deputy chairman of the State Duma; in 1995, he was appointed Chairman of the Joint Commission of the Federal Assembly, the President and the Government of the Russian Federation for cooperation in legislative activities; was the head of the delegation of the State Duma in the North Atlantic Assembly; in December 1995, he was elected a deputy of the State Duma of the Federal Assembly of the Russian Federation of the second convocation, but refused the mandate due to being in public service; since February 1996 - Plenipotentiary Representative of the President in the Constitutional Court; from December 1996 to April 1998 - First Deputy Secretary of the Security Council; April-June 1998 - head of the department of the Presidential Administration for pardons; author of more than a hundred published scientific papers in the field of constitutional law, the history of nation-state building, civil and criminal law, and the judiciary; Professor of the Department of Constitutional and International Law, Tomsk University; Honored Lawyer of the Russian Federation; married, has three children.

Actively participated in social and political activities since 1989, was one of the organizers in Khakassia of the democratic club of voters and deputies "Citizen". He was one of the founders of the "Choice of Russia" movement, was a member of the FER party, but in connection with the transition to public service, he suspended his membership in the party. In the Supreme Council of the Russian Federation, he was a member of the deputy commission to investigate the causes and circumstances of the attempted coup d'état in the USSR in August 1991. Participated in the work of the Constitutional Conference (April 29 - November 10, 1993), was a member of the Commission to finalize the draft Constitution of the Russian Federation in 1993 In May 1997, he became a member of the Commission for the Development of the Draft Program of State Construction in the Russian Federation.

Mikhail Alekseevich Mityukov (January 7, 1942, Ust-Uda village) - statesman, legal scholar, candidate of legal sciences (1979). Honored Lawyer of the Russian Federation (1993).

After graduating from high school, he worked as a fitter and served in the army. In 1968 he graduated from the Faculty of Law of the Irkutsk State University. From 1968 to 1987 he worked as a judge of the Khakass regional court, deputy chairman of this court. In 1979 he defended his Ph.D. thesis at Tomsk State University on the topic: "Legislation on Autonomous Regions (State-Legal Research)". Since 1987 - Head of the Department of History of the USSR and Jurisprudence of the Abakan State Pedagogical Institute.

On March 18, 1990, he was elected People's Deputy of the RSFSR for the Altai Territorial District No. 212. In 1990–93 he was Deputy Chairman, then Chairman of the Committee on Legislation of the Supreme Council of the Russian Federation, member of the Presidium of the Supreme Council of the Russian Federation, member of the Constitutional Commission of the Russian Federation. In 1993-94 - Chairman of the Commission for Legislative Suggestions under the President of the Russian Federation, First Deputy Minister of Justice of the Russian Federation. Participated in the work of the Constitutional Conference on the preparation of the draft Constitution of the Russian Federation (1993). 12/12/1993 elected to the State Duma of the Federal Assembly of the Russian Federation in the Khakass constituency No. 31 (nominated by the electoral bloc "Russia's Choice"). In 1993-96 - First Deputy Chairman of the State Duma of the Federal Assembly of the Russian Federation. From February 5 to December 7, 1996 - Plenipotentiary Representative of the President of the Russian Federation in the Constitutional Court of the Russian Federation. In 1996-98 - First Deputy Secretary of the Security Council of the Russian Federation. On June 29, 1998, he was again appointed Plenipotentiary Representative of the President of the Russian Federation in the Constitutional Court of the Russian Federation, having worked in this position until November 7, 2005.

He has scientific works on constitutional law. He studied the problems of organization and activities of constitutional justice bodies.

He was awarded the Orders of Honor (2001) and "For Services to the Fatherland" IV degree (2005).

Compositions

  1. Constitutional justice in the subjects of the Russian Federation. M., 1997;
  2. Constitutional justice in the CIS and Baltic countries. M., 1998;
  3. Constitutional courts in the post-Soviet space. M., 1999;
  4. On the history of constitutional justice in Russia. M., 2002; Constitutional Meeting of 1993: the birth of the Constitution of Russia. M., 2014.

Mityukov Mikhail Alekseevich- Plenipotentiary Representative of the President of the Russian Federation in the Constitutional Court of the Russian Federation.

PhD in Law. Professor, State Counselor of Justice 1st class. Acting State Councilor of the Russian Federation, 1st class. Honored Lawyer of the Russian Federation.

Author of more than 200 works on constitutional law and constitutional justice, nation-building, judiciary, civil and criminal law, including several monographs.

From 1968 to 1987 - on judicial, and then teaching work in Siberia. Since 1989 M.A. Mityukov is actively involved in political activities. In 1990 he was elected a people's deputy of the RSFSR. In the Supreme Soviet of the RSFSR, he became Deputy Chairman of the Committee on Legislation, and since November 1991 - Chairman of the Committee on Legislation and a member of the Supreme Soviet of the RSFSR. At the same time he was a member of the Constitutional Commission of the RSFSR.

Member of the Constitutional Conference under the President of the Russian Federation in the commission for finalizing the draft Constitution of the Russian Federation.

Since September 26, 1993 - Chairman of the Commission for Legislative Suggestions under the President of the Russian Federation and at the same time - First Deputy Minister of Justice of Russia.

On December 12, 1993, he was elected to the State Duma of the first convocation in the Khakas single-mandate constituency No. 31, and on January 11, 1994, at a meeting of the State Duma, he was elected First Deputy Chairman of the State Duma and dealt with planning and coordinating legislative activities. He was the head of the Duma delegation to the North Atlantic Assembly. He led the coordinating committees of the CIS Parliamentary Assembly on the creation of a number of model codes.

In November 1994, by Presidential Decree, he was appointed Chairman of the Joint Commission for the Coordination of the Legislative Activities of the Federal Assembly, the President and the Government of the Russian Federation. He was Deputy Chairman of the Coordinating Council of the Federal Assembly and the constituent entities of the Russian Federation for cooperation on legislative activities.

From February 25 to December 1996 - Plenipotentiary Representative of the President of the Russian Federation in the Constitutional Court of the Russian Federation.

December 7, 1996 appointed First Deputy Secretary of the Security Council of the Russian Federation, in charge of constitutional security issues.

From April to June 1998 - Head of the Office of the President of the Russian Federation for pardons.

Professor of the Department of Constitutional and International Law at Tomsk State University and the Academy of Labor and Social Relations. He has a diploma from the D. Kennedy School of Public Administration of Harvard University. Conducts training of graduate students and reads a special course on constitutional justice.

On June 27, 1998, he was again appointed Plenipotentiary Representative of the President of the Russian Federation in the Constitutional Court of the Russian Federation.

He has a number of state awards: the Order of Honor, the medals "Defender of Free Russia", "In memory of the 850th anniversary of Moscow", the insignia "For Impeccable Service" of the XXV years.
